The Telomere Effect | How to Look Young at Sixty
In The Telomere Effect, Nobel-wining author Blackburn and Psychologist Epel show you how Telomeres affect your ageing and health and show you how to stay young and healthy.

The Case Against Sugar | Reviews, Summary | Gary Taubes
In The Case Against Sugar, Gary Taubes takes you to the root cause of obesity and shows how the sugar lobby successfully diverted the scientific discourse for more than a century and pushed the blame on the victims. here’s our review of The case Against Sugar.
